Unificar tablas

Hola, tengo 1000 tablas dentro de una BD SQL Server. Todas son iguales. Quiero usarlas desde Access 2003. Me gustaría saber de que manera puedo unificarlas en una sola tabla para poder ver todos los datos juntos desde Access. Las tengo en SQL Server porque son tablas muy extensas y Access falla cuando supera su limite de registros. Gracias por adelantado

1 respuesta

Respuesta
1
Podrías hacer un :
INSERT INTO TX(X1,X2,Xn)
(SELECT X1,X2,Xn
FROM T1
UNION
SELECT X1,X2,Xn
FROM T1
UNION
SELECT X1,X2,Xn
FROM T3)
Te unificaría los datos en una sola tabla TX.
Guardarla en un super txt y luego importarla en el access.
Sino el tamaño excede pasa de a una tabla al access.
La verdad yo pensaría en sumarizar los datos y guardar solo lo necesario tipo un datawarehouse. Pero eso dependerá del tipo de información que estas manejando.
Éxitos
KAOS
Esta solución estaría bien si no fueran tantas tablas. De todas maneras, no me vale la pena, una tabla con tantas filas me ira demasiado lento. Gracias igualmente

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as